Avis Car Hiire when in Florida (Getting car hire when out there)

Hi

I am planning to stay at Cabana Bay and was looking to hire a car for a couple of days whilst I am staying there.

I have a couple of questions if anybody knows?
1. How does car insurance work if I am getting car hire out there? i.e. do I have to have my own, or do they incorporate the cost into the car hire?
2. I understand there is a charge for parking at Cabana bay - Does this apply to car's hired from their on-site car hire?

I only have experience of hiring cars from the airport for the whole duration of our holidays I'm afraid.

The safest (and cheapest ) option I guess if you know what dates you want is to pre-book through a UK broker such as Netflights, usrentacar or our favourite by far Andy at DFCH.

By booking through one of them you can be sure that you will have the important insurances. CDW with no excess and $1m SLI. The problem for us UK drivers is that American drivers have all the appropriate insurances already covered. I'm not sure how you can add those insurances at the local desk without paying excessively.
